PLEASE HELP ASAP!!!!! What is the ratio of the volumes of a cylinder and a cone have the same base radius and height? Explain. PLEASE HELP ASAP

The ratio of the volume of cylinder and cone is 3:1
Because the volume of:
Cylinder = The area of base x height
Cone     = 1/3 The area of base x height
